Ingredients
Scale
- 6 large eggs
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 1 tsp Dijon mustard
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
- 6 black olives (for decoration)
- Fresh chives or parsley (for garnish)
Instructions
- Boil the eggs: Place eggs in a saucepan, cover with cold water, and bring to a boil. Cover, remove from heat, and let stand for 12 minutes.
- Cool and peel: Transfer eggs to ice water for cooling. Peel under running water.
- Prepare the filling: Cut eggs in half lengthwise; scoop yolks into a bowl. Mix yolks with mayonnaise, mustard, salt, pepper, and paprika until smooth.
- Fill the egg whites: Pipe or spoon the yolk mixture back into the egg whites.
- Create spiders: Slice black olives into rounds; use one round for the body and two for legs per egg. Arrange on top of filled eggs.
- Chill & serve: Refrigerate until ready to serve.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 12 minutes
